Organic Quinoa provides numerous health benefits due to its rich nutritional profile. Quinoa has:

High in Protein: Contains all nine essential amino acids that the body cannot produce on its own, Gluten-Free, Rich in Fiber: High in Fiber, which can help lower cholesterol levels, promote digestive health, and support healthy blood sugar levels, Antioxidant Properties: Contains manganese, which help protect the body from oxidative stress and inflammation, Miner-Rich: Good source of minerals like iron, magnesium, and potassium, which are essential for maintaining healthy blood cells, bones, and heart function.

When purchasing quinoa, choose organic options to avoid exposure to pesticides and other chemicals. Rinse quinoa thoroughly before cooking to remove saponins, which can give it a bitter taste.
